编程转语言,编程转语言怎么写简历
目前世界上的计算机编程主要仍是英语,未来会否出现中文的计算机编程?你期待吗?
我百分的期待中文的计算机编程,要想达到目的,必须把核的问题解决了,有了中文的bios路基就算有了,我想如果用中文的拼音做基础,汉语语音翻译做分析,能够定性汉语语意,再加上别的技术做服务,应该能解决。
编程,跟自然语言几乎无关。把if then 换成 如果 那么 并不会有利于编程,不会的人还是不会。
现在的编程语言,是脱胎于英语的特殊符号语言,并不是自然英语。
变量函数名等等,早就可以用汉语了,Unicode解决了这些问题。
只有几个关键字现在要求用所谓的英文,软件平台厂家要想改也很容易做。
再有就是软件平台的菜单,菜单很容易改,把 file 改成文件,汉化软件大都这么做。
帮助文件汉化确实有必要,但已经不属于本问题提到的汉语编程问题了。
呼吁用汉语编程的,都是从来不编程的人吧。
易语言,汉化了菜单,可以用 如果 那么。。。。。但它不过是预编译,把汉语源文件翻译成英语程序外挂调用VB,不是自己的编译系统,根本就算不上是一门编程语言。
与其呼吁汉语编程环境,不如呼吁国家力量研制中国人自己的编译系统,也就连带自己的操作系统,自己的BIOS!!!
理论上,任何一种文字都可以编程。关键在于处理器(芯片)的电路设计,再将这种电路设计做成处理器,让处理器能够识别你输入的文字符号(对应于设计好的命令及运算符),并进行相应的运算与输出。再将输出转换成你使用的文字。
文字图案复杂且数量庞大的话,电路肯定更复杂,运算速度也会降低不少。
英语只有26个字符,是目前最简单的输入符号。
我们缺的就是芯片电路设计专家、芯片制作技术和制作设备。一个指甲大小的处理器(芯片),如果用肉眼可见的导线来连接的话,其体积可能相当于一幢三单元三十层的楼房。
买别人的芯片,就只能按照别人设计好的程序语言。
国内业界已经在越来越多地使用中文命名标识符,包括变量、方法、类名等等。国内软件业的竞争加剧将会使母语命名的优势更加凸显。简而言之,既然需求、设计文档都是用中文写的,代码中的业务相关命名可以照搬文档中的术语,而不是强行取一个生硬而不易理解的英文命名。
这里必须点出一些常见的误区:“英语够好,就该在项目里用英文命名所有标识符”,以及对应的“某些标识符很难用英文命名,说明我该去补习英文,或者干脆用拼音命名”。
英文水平再好,对绝大多数国人来说也只是第二语言,无论是读和写的效率都不如母语——中文。而大多数英文编程语言都支持非ASC码命名标识符,初衷就是为了便于非英语母语的开发者直接用母语命名。
不信的先把下面实际前端项目中使用的中文变量改成英文命名写出来看看,哪个更好读。
这还只是用中文编程的第一步。下面,会有更多的API使用中文命名,比如中文JavaScript的绘图库例程:
顺其自然地,最后一块拼板就是实现中文语法的编程语言,包括关键字和语法格式。
这个根本没必要,编程中常用的英文也就几十个,总共用的也就三两百个,[_a***_]高中生都认识,中文反到没英文方便录入,编程重在思路,就跟一个好的作家是哪个国家用哪种语言写的作品一样无关
计算机语言能否从''机器语言、汇编语言、C语言…发展到用人类语言开发软件?
首先,随着人工智能技术的不断发展,未来使用自然语言来编写计算机指令代码将逐渐成为现实,其实目前有不少计算机语言已经越来越接近自然语言了。
编程语言之所以不能完全***用自然语言来进行编写,原因说到底就是目前的计算机系统还不够“智能”,由于自然语言的表达方式非常丰富且存在一定的“歧义性”,所以单纯地通过字符解析的方式可能无法完全捕获用户的实际意图,所以目前的编程语言往往都有严格的限定,或者说编程语言远没有自然语言复杂。
对于一部分跨考到计算机专业的研究生来说,往往对学习新的编程语言有一定的顾虑,我经常愿意拿编程语言与自然语言做对比来鼓励学生,其实如果说学习一门新的自然语言需要用“年”来计算的话,那么学习编程语言往往可以用“周”来计算,所以从这个角度来看,学习编程语言还是比较容易的。
目前在人工智能研究的六大主要方向当中,自然语言处理就是一个比较热门的方向,当自然语言处理发展到一定阶段的时候,一些简单的程序设计工作完全可以通过自然语言来进行描述,当然这个过程需要较长一段时间。另外,由于自然语言在表述的过程中可能会附带一定的感***彩和肢体动作,所以要想能够全面捕获用户的意图,往往还需要视觉系统的配合,这也在一定程度上提升了处理的难度。但庆幸的是,目前计算机视觉和自然语言处理正是人工智能领域的热门。
我从事互联网行业多年,目前也在带计算机专业的研究生,主要的研究方向集中在大数据和人工智能领域,我会陆续写一些关于互联网技术方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。
如果有互联网、大数据、人工智能等方面的问题,或者是考研方面的问题,都可以在评论区留言!
[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.wnpsw.com/post/11126.html